ArmInfo. PicsArt has acquired its first company, which turned out to be a resident of the 3rd cycle of the Beeline Startup Incubator project, implemented by "Beeline Armenia" company together with the Business Angels Association of Armenia (BANA).
As the press service of the company reports, PicsArt has acquired its first company - D'efekt application, which gives an opportunity to create visual content with the help of artificial intelligence.
In particular, D'efekt specializes in video editing, providing the ability to use motion effects. With the acquisition of D'efekt, PicsArt will be able to attract users of apps like TikTok, YouTube and Instagram to help them create more engaging videos. At the moment there are no plans to merge the applications, but soon D'efekt will receive a new name, which will contain the PicsArt word. PicsArt is reportedly one of the most successful startups in the world with total funding of $ 54 million.

To note, Beeline Startup Incubator with all its resources contributes to the intensive growth of startups, thus ensuring their entry into the international market. Participants are provided with a free working platform, trainings and master classes in business, management, marketing, PR are held. Selected resident startups benefit from incubator resources, expert advice and opportunities to work in an active business environment for 14 weeks.
To note, the PicsArt company specializes in photo and video editing. The head office of the company is located in San Francisco (USA), the largest office is in Yerevan, in the Tumo Center for Creative Technologies. The app has over 600 million downloads and 130 million monthly active users. PicsArt has been translated into 30 languages. Since its launch in 2011, the app has been at the top of Google Play, and in January 2019, PicsArt was ranked # 2 in the international ranking of free apps on iTunes. The company received funding from top venture capital firms Sequoia Capital, DCM Ventures, Insight Venture Partners, Siguler Guff and Company for a totalthe amount of $ 45 million
